Description:

The Student Office Assistant is the first point of contact for students meeting with academic, and career advisors. You will need to be able to communicate information to and from students cordially while maintaining confidentiality with private information. You will talk to students, parents, and staff in person, over the phone, and over email to schedule appointments, answer questions, and direct them to the correct department. This will allow you to become well-acquainted with other offices on campus. This is a friendly and fast-paced work environment with multiple duties. This position requires patience, understanding, and positivity. You will encounter SUU students & staff from many different backgrounds, so it is imperative that you are kind and respectful.

Daily duties may include:

  • Answering/making phone calls to current & potential students, appointment scheduling, and clear communication with various departments, staff, & students.
  • Assist others in the office as needed.
  • Maintain office cleanliness and supplies, retrieve mail, and perform occasional errands around campus as needed.
